GE14: What's At Stake In East Malaysia? (Part 2)

Bridget Welsh, Professor of Political Science, John Cabot University | Jahabar Sadiq, Veteran Journalist

09-May-18 20:00

GE14: What's At Stake In East Malaysia? (Part 2)

Once seen as BN's fixed deposit, anticipation was rife that the tides would turn in East Malaysia this GE14. At this junction, Bridget and Jahabar join Sharaad to talk about voting trends, the phenomenal movement to bring East Malaysians home to vote, and the complicated dynamics that have seen Sabah & Sarawak moving in different directions since the last elections. 

Presented by: Sharaad Kuttan
